The global air driven handpieces market is set for steady expansion through 2033, with demand supported by higher dental procedure volumes, equipment replacement cycles, and wider adoption in private clinics and ambulatory settings. The market is estimated at about USD 1.18 billion in 2026 and is projected to reach roughly USD 1.86 billion by 2033, reflecting a CAGR of 6.7% from 2026 to 2033. Air driven handpieces remain a core tool in restorative dentistry, prosthodontics, and general oral care because they offer lower upfront cost, familiar handling, and easy integration into existing dental chairs and compressed air systems. Demand is being shaped by rising treatment backlogs, the growth of cosmetic dentistry, and the continued preference for compact, serviceable instruments in high-throughput practices.
From 2019 to 2025, the market moved through a sharp disruption and recovery cycle. Before 2020, annual demand advanced at a mid-single-digit pace, but clinic closures and deferred elective procedures caused a visible dip in 2020 and part of 2021, particularly in urban outpatient channels. By 2022 and 2023, replacement demand returned strongly as dental visits normalized, while manufacturers benefited from leaner inventories and renewed purchasing by group practices. In 2025, the market is estimated near USD 1.11 billion, still below the full potential implied by aging installed bases and uneven access in emerging economies. The 2026 base year marks a more stable footing, with the market broadening from about 38 million units sold globally in 2025 to closer to 41 million units in 2026, while premium product mix and service contracts lift average selling values.

By type, high-speed air driven handpieces account for the largest share of the market, making up about 58% of 2026 revenue, because they are central to restorative work and time-sensitive procedures. Low-speed models hold roughly 29% share, supported by polishing, endodontic, and finishing tasks, while specialist and accessory formats make up the balance. By application, general dentistry remains the anchor at about 46% of demand, followed by restorative and cosmetic procedures at 31%, with endodontics, oral surgery support, and lab-related use filling out the remainder. Regionally, North America leads in value, Europe follows closely on replacement demand, and Asia Pacific is the fastest-growing block in volume terms. The mix is increasingly shaped by purchasing patterns rather than pure procedure counts, and distributors that segment inventory by clinical use case are better positioned to defend margins.
Several forces are pushing the market forward at the same time. Dental disease prevalence remains high across both mature and developing economies, and delayed care during the pandemic created a replacement and catch-up effect that is still visible in 2026 ordering patterns. Private clinic expansion, cosmetic procedures, and the steady aging of populations in Japan, Europe, and North America are increasing daily use intensity, which shortens replacement cycles. Another important factor is the preference for air driven tools in cost-sensitive markets where compressed air infrastructure already exists and where clinicians want dependable performance without a large capital burden. The market also benefits from the fact that many clinics buy more than one handpiece per chair, creating recurring demand that is not dependent on a single equipment event.
Constraints are real and prevent the market from growing faster. Electric handpieces are taking share in some high-end practices because they offer stronger torque and more consistent performance in certain procedures, especially where precision is valued above price. Maintenance costs, bearing wear, and sterilization-related degradation also shorten product life and can make purchasers hesitate if service support is weak. In lower-income markets, price sensitivity remains the biggest restraint, and many clinics continue to delay replacement until failure forces action. Supply chain volatility in small components and motor parts can also create uneven availability, which is why several distributors now hold more safety stock than they did before 2020.

Technology trends are focused on practical gains rather than dramatic reinvention. Manufacturers are improving turbine balance, bearing life, chuck retention, and noise control, while also making handpieces lighter and easier to sterilize. Better anti-retraction design and improved hygiene protection are becoming standard selling points, especially for clinics concerned with cross-contamination risk. Some brands are integrating usage tracking and maintenance reminders into digital service platforms, which helps clinics manage replacement timing and reduces unexpected downtime. These changes do not alter the basic role of air driven handpieces, but they do improve the economics of ownership and create a clearer distinction between commodity products and premium offerings.

Competition is moderately fragmented, with global dental equipment brands, regional specialists, and lower-cost manufacturers all active across different price bands. Buyers typically compare torque consistency, head size, sterilization tolerance, noise, and service turnaround before price alone, which gives established brands an edge in larger clinics and institutional accounts. Private label and OEM supply are also important, especially in Asia and parts of Europe, where distributors often shape the final market offer under their own labels. Pricing discipline matters because the market can quickly become promotional when inventory builds up, so firms with stronger channel control and repair networks tend to perform better.
